The mature respiratory tract is composed of the nasal
cavity, nasopharynx, larynx, the tubular conducting
airways including trachea, intra- and extrapulmonary
bronchi, bronchioles, and the gas exchange system
including terminal bronchioles and alveoli where gas
exchange occurs. The lungs and chest cavity are covered
in a thin, translucent pleural membrane.
There are two separate blood-conducting systems in
the lungs. The pulmonary artery system supplies venous
blood from the right ventricle to the capillary plexus
